thirty-seven million, nine hundred ninety-six thousand, eight hundred thirty-seven
Currency £37996837 in british english: thirty-seven million, nine hundred ninety-six thousand, eight hundred thirty-seven Pound.
In Price: 37996837.00
36996837 | 38996837